1. What is the Internet of Things?

The Internet of Things is not only the interconnection of networks and objects, enterprises, people and everything, but also the business and application of information technology. It is the use of communication technologies such as local networks or the Internet to connect sensors, controllers, machines, people and things together in a new way, forming a connection between people and things, things and things, and realizing informatization, remote management control and intelligence network of.

4. What does the Internet of Things rely on to achieve interconnection?

In order to enable the interconnection of various "local Internet of Things" and even individual items, a super protocol that is compatible with various coding and standard protocols and can be seamlessly integrated with the Internet is needed to unify the network. Scientists have developed A kind of identification called Open Object Identifier or OID. This is a protocol standard rule and coding method for global compliance. It is jointly promulgated and implemented by ISO (International Standards Organization), ITU (International Telecommunication Union) and IEC (National Electrotechnical Organization). It is currently used by 208 countries and regions around the world. adopted by the region.

5. What is the difference between IoT OID and Internet domain name?

1. The leading organization is different, and the OID of the Internet of Things is uniformly assigned by the international standard organization that participates in the world. Each country manages its own territory, and they can communicate with each other. The security mechanism is higher than the Internet domain name, with both a high degree of autonomy and global interoperability. China is the biggest supporter and user of the whole system.

2. The form of expression is different. The OID node and length of the Internet of Things are not limited. Theoretically speaking, it can be defined to every grain of sand in the sea.

3. Terminals are different. IoT OID defines item terminals (whether physical or virtual), while Internet domain names define computer terminals.

7. How to identify OID, trace the source, and prevent counterfeiting?

The reshaping of the industrial chain structure by the OID system is very obvious, changing the long linear value chain of "upstream-midstream-downstream" in most traditional industries; with the development of the information industry, big data can truly monitor user behavior Analysis, so as to feed back to the upstream, is conducive to the adjustment of industrial structure and the digital transformation of the real industry. Divided into four levels in technology application

(1) Perception layer: data collection (generate management data, production data, inflow and outflow data, etc.);

(2) Communication layer: data upload (real-time recording);

(3) Storage layer: data cloud storage;

(4) Application layer: various applications (sales data, market preference data, consumer behavior data, etc.).

It can be seen from this that as long as OID has applications, it will inevitably form big data, from item production data, circulation data, sales data, consumption behavior, preference data, all will enter the storage layer (public cloud, private cloud and other clouds) , forming massive data, so various big data will be generated through OID applications. Without OID applications, there will be no accurate big data in the Internet of Things society. Of course, big data is also inseparable from the popularization of various business forms of the Internet of Things. OID makes it impossible to tamper with any original record data, which is advantageous for anti-counterfeiting and traceability of products. At the same time, the data gathered by OID is not only undisclosed, but also highly confidential. This is obviously different from the blockchain. OID focuses more on the overall regulatory needs.
